CS4345-CZZR Description
The CS4345-CZZR is a high-performance, 24-bit digital-to-analog converter (DAC) designed for audio applications. Manufactured by Cirrus Logic Inc., this IC belongs to the Popguard® series and is optimized for superior audio quality and minimal power consumption. The CS4345-CZZR features a SPI data interface, making it compatible with a wide range of microcontrollers and processors. It operates within a voltage supply range of 3V to 3.47V and 5V, ensuring flexibility in power supply options. The device is available in a Surface Mount package, specifically in a Tape & Reel (TR) format, which is ideal for automated assembly processes. With a sampling rate of 192k samples per second, the CS4345-CZZR delivers high-fidelity audio output. This DAC is designed for single supply operation and is RoHS3 compliant, REACH unaffected, and classified under HTSUS code 8542.39.0001. The product is currently in the Last Time Buy status, making it a valuable component for existing designs and final production runs.
CS4345-CZZR Features
- 24-bit Resolution: The CS4345-CZZR offers a high resolution of 24 bits, ensuring precise audio reproduction and minimal quantization noise.
- 192k Sampling Rate: With a sampling rate of 192k samples per second, this DAC supports high-quality audio playback, suitable for professional audio applications.
- SPI Interface: The SPI data interface simplifies integration with various digital systems, providing a straightforward and efficient communication protocol.
- Single Supply Operation: The device operates on a single supply voltage, ranging from 3V to 3.47V and 5V, which reduces the complexity of power supply design.
- Surface Mount Packaging: The Surface Mount package type and Tape & Reel (TR) format are ideal for automated assembly, ensuring high production efficiency and reliability.
- Popguard® Series: As part of the Popguard® series, the CS4345-CZZR is designed to minimize audio artifacts and ensure smooth power-up and power-down sequences.
- Compliance and Safety: The CS4345-CZZR is RoHS3 compliant and REACH unaffected, meeting stringent environmental and safety standards. It also has a Moisture Sensitivity Level (MSL) of 3 (168 Hours), ensuring robustness in manufacturing environments.
